OPINION OF THE COURT Chief Judge Breitel. Plaintiff Mary Simonds, decedent’s first wife, seeks to impress a constructive trust on proceeds of insurance policies on decedent’s life. The proceeds had been paid to the named beneficiaries, defendants Reva Simonds, decedent’s second wife, and their daughter Gayle.
